Transpennine Express

About
Transpennine Express is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from Manchester and Liverpool to Scotland, the North East and Yorkshire. It offers a range of services, including express, regional and local trains. Express trains are the fastest, with journey times of up to three hours. Regional trains are slower, but offer more stops and a more relaxed atmosphere. Local trains are the slowest, but offer the most stops. Transpennine Express offers a range of ticket types, including single, return, group and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for Transpennine Express are Manchester to Edinburgh, Liverpool to Leeds and Manchester to York. These routes offer a convenient and comfortable way to travel between the cities.

Complete guide to Doncaster

Things to do in Doncaster

Discover the best of Doncaster —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Doncaster trip today.

  • Recommended

Danum Gallery, Library and Museum

A city-centre museum with Roman and social history displays, local artefacts and changing exhibitions that introduce Doncaster's past.

  • Recommended

South Yorkshire Aircraft Museum

An aviation museum at the former RAF airfield, featuring military aircraft, cockpit displays and volunteers sharing local flying history.

Doncaster Railway Heritage Centre

A working heritage railway site with station exhibits, historic rolling stock and a compact museum atmosphere for rail enthusiasts.

In Doncaster, you can explore Brodsworth Hall and Gardens, a beautifully preserved Victorian country house with stunning gardens. Enjoy birdwatching and walking trails at Potteric Carr Nature Reserve, or have fun at The Dome, a leisure complex with swimming pools and ice skating. Discover local history at Doncaster Museum and Art Gallery, or visit Boston Park Farm for family-friendly encounters with animals and a maize maze. For the best sights, visit Conisbrough Castle for panoramic views, Yorkshire Wildlife Park for exotic animals, and Doncaster Racecourse for major horse racing events. Explore Cusworth Hall with its museum and gardens, and learn about aviation at the South Yorkshire Aircraft Museum.
A two to three-day visit in Doncaster is ideal to explore its main attractions, including the Yorkshire Wildlife Park, Doncaster Racecourse, and the historic Mansion House.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Warrington Central: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category A station, please note there are no tactile pavings at this station - Step free access is available to both platforms at the station. Customer Lifts are available from first to last train,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users can use car park equipment at this station unaided,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Wheelchairs available open hours: As per ticket office opening hours,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
